I agree with 1000 calories a slice being too much, but you can make a few small changes to cut the calories almost in half. Replace the sugar with Splenda, replace the original Cool Whip with the fat free version, and cut your pie into 12 slices. The calorie count drops to 600. If you still want the bigger slices, you can still drop 100 over 100 calories a slice by making the substitutions. I think you can buy fat free evaporated milk too.

Make sure bacon is very crisp. Use 1/2 the chocolate sauce or it makes it soggy.
I made my own adjustments after making it as the recipe states...I used a chocolate cookie crust. Used 8 pieces of bacon instead of 6. Used 2 bananas instead of 1. Freeze pie for 30 minutes then drizzle Magic Chocolate Shell ice cream topping on top, then moved it to the fridge.
